The legality of online gambling varies significantly across jurisdictions, representing a complex web of regulations and restrictions. Some countries have fully embraced online casinos, establishing comprehensive licensing frameworks and consumer protection measures. Others maintain strict prohibitions, while many fall into a gray area, with limited regulation or enforcement. Before participating in any online casino, it’s crucial to understand the specific laws governing its operation and your own residency. Ignoring these regulations can lead to both legal and financial repercussions, including voided winnings and potential prosecution. The legal landscape is constantly evolving, so staying informed is paramount.
Licensing jurisdictions, such as Malta, Gibraltar, and the Isle of Man, are often seen as reputable indicators of a casino’s legitimacy and commitment to fair play. These authorities impose stringent standards on operators, overseeing aspects like game integrity, security protocols, and responsible gambling initiatives. However, a license alone isn't a guarantee of trustworthiness; it's essential to research the specific operator and read reviews from other players to assess its overall reputation. Independent auditing and testing agencies, like eCOGRA, further enhance transparency by verifying the fairness of game outcomes.

Online casinos frequently entice new players with attractive bonuses and promotions, such as welcome bonuses, deposit matches, and free spins. However, it’s essential to carefully read the terms and conditions associated with these offers, as they often come with wagering requirements, maximum bet limits, and game restrictions. Wagering requirements specify the amount you must b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able. Understanding these conditions is crucial to avoid disappointment and ensure you can actually benefit from the promotion.
Beyond welcome bonuses, look for ongoing promotions, loyalty programs, and VIP rewards. These can provide added value and enhance your overall gaming experience. However, be wary of overly generous bonuses that seem too good to be true, as they may be associated with unreasonably high wagering requirements or other restrictive terms. A transparent and fair bonus structure is a hallmark of a reputable casino.

Bankroll management is arguably the most important aspect of successful gambling. Before you start playing, set a budget and stick to it.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ly deplete your funds. Divide your bankroll into smaller units and b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each game. This approach allows you to weather losing streaks and prolong your gaming session. Furthermore, it's wise to set win limits and cash out when you reach them, preventing you from giving back your winnings.
Different games require different strategies. In blackjack, learning basic strategy charts can significantly reduce the house edge. In poker, mastering hand rankings, bluffing techniques, and position play is essential for success. For slots, understanding the paytable, volatility, and bonus features can help you make informed betting decisions. Research and practice are crucial for developing proficiency in any casino game. Many online resources offer detailed guides and tutorials on various gambling strategies. Remember to practice in demo mode before risking real money.
Understanding volatility is particularly important when choosing slots. High-volatility slots offer the potential for larger payouts but come with increased risk, while low-volatility slots provide more frequent, smaller wins. Choosing a slot that aligns with your risk tolerance and bankroll is essential. While the potential for winning is appealing, it’s paramount to approach online casino real money gaming with a commitment to responsible play.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ling – such as chasing losses, gambling with money you can't afford to lose, or neglecting personal responsibilities – is the first step towards addressing it. Many online casinos offer self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and other tools to help players control their gambling habits. Utilizing these resources is a sign of strength, not weakness.
Seeking support from organizations dedicated to responsible gambling is also crucial if you or someone you know is struggling with a gambling problem. Resources like the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ous provide confidential support, guidance, and referral services.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ial or emotional distress.
